Annie L' Huillier-Nobel Prize Physics 2023

-Karthik Gurumurthy

Annie L'Huillier was unreachable on the morning of the 2023 Nobel Prize in Physics.

The Royal Swedish Academy of Sciences tried reaching L'Huillier to tell her she was one of the 2023 physics laureates. However, her phone kept going to voicemail.

Luckily, they were able to reach L'Huillier's husband. He explained that she was teaching a class on atomic physics, but she would have only a very short break just before the announcement.

During the break, L'Huillier picked up her phone and received the news about the physics prize, but she cut the call short to return to her students. Before going back to class, she turned her phone off again.

When she returned to the class, she told the students she would have to finish a few minutes early but did not give a reason.

L'Huillier ended the lecture only five minutes before the 11:45 physics announcement and left the room. Suspicious, her students decided to stay and watch the physics livestream in the lecture hall.

When L'Huillier's name was announced, her students broke into cheers. Annie L'Huillier's dedication to her students and her passion for teaching atomic physics is truly admirable. This is a personal message from 2022 chemistry laureate Carolyn Bertozzi to all young researchers on why to aspire for a career in science:

”I would want to share with them how a life in science is incredibly rewarding. It is rewarding because it is creating. You are discovering knowledge and gifting that to humanity for all of prosperity. Because once you learn something no one can take that way. It is not an object. It is in intellectual currency that will be shared throughout the generations. And you created that. It has a permanency that ironically a physical object doesn’t have. You can paint a painting, but eventually it will fade. But knowledge doesn’t fade. Knowledge stays with us forever and it becomes the foundation for the next generations.”

After winning the Nobel prize for his work, he visited his old high school. While there, he decided to look up his records. He was surprised to find that his performance were not as good as he had remembered them. And he got a kick out of the fact that his IQ was 124, not much above average.

Dr. Feynman saw that winning the Nobel prize was one thing, but to win it with an IQ of only 124 was really something. Most of us would agree because we all assume that the winners of Nobel prizes have exceptionally high IQs. Feynman confided that he always assumed that he had.

If Feynman had known he was really just a bit above average in the IQ department, we wonder if he would have had the audacity to launch the unique and creative research experiments that would eventually win him the greatest recognition the scientific community can give.

Perhaps not. Maybe the knowledge that he was a cut above average, but not in the genius category, would have influenced what he tried to achieve. After all, from childhood most of us have been led to believe that ordinary people don't accomplish extraordinary feats.
